Posted by owien on Mar-27-2009 16:57:

a quick question for you airbase. when you sit down and go about making tunes do you think about only making tracks that work well on the dance floor. or do you keep it personal and go with the flow until you create something you like.

thanks for any input you may give. as i think its good to hear what pros say.


Posted by Airbase on Mar-28-2009 16:44:

Back in the days, I never had a dancefloor in mind making the music. These days, I however always keep the dancefloor in mind somewhere back in my head. Like "don't make that break so long, people will get bored" etc
